Because I had a bit of time I ran the script against two fresh MariaDB containers on my workstation and here are the numbers, which look more realistic

5.5.36
mysql::select_version::q/s....................... 43227
mysql::select_all::q/s........................... 21382
mysql::seq_insert::q/s............................. 165
mysql::update::q/s................................. 157
mysql::update_with_index::q/s...................... 161
mysql::transaction_insert::t/s..................... 157
mysql::delete::q/s................................. 159

10.11.6
mysql::select_version::q/s....................... 65544
mysql::select_all::q/s............................ 5134
mysql::seq_insert::q/s............................. 116
mysql::update::q/s................................. 161
mysql::update_with_index::q/s.................... 18419
mysql::transaction_insert::t/s..................... 155
mysql::delete::q/s................................. 122

As you can see some interesting differences:
- SELECT * being way slower on 10.11 on this benchmark 
- UPDATE with index much faster on 10.11

the rest looks quite similar (benchmarking select version is without much interest...)

I'm going to take my best guess here and assume that the 5.5 benchmark results are false results, which I am honestly surprised that nobody noticed before.
4M inserts or updates per second is completely unrealistic in real life scenarios.
I gave a quick look to that benchmark script; it's single threaded and does no error checking at all. There is just no way such a script could reach 4M inserts per second, so I'm concluding you're just benchmarking errors here and nothing gets written to the DB.

If you want to corroborate my theory just look at SHOW GLOBAL STATUS LIKE 'Com_Insert' and  SHOW GLOBAL STATUS LIKE 'Com_Update' counters on this DB. It should tell you how many inserts/updates have been recorded.

I don't want to criticize the PHP script author's work, because his script might be perfectly fine for most situations, but if you want to do accurate DB benchmarking you should give a try to Sysbench.

The only way there can be that big a difference is if there is a flushing discrepancy in cofiguration.

Have you verified your settings are actually the same, particularly the ones containing "flush" and "sync" substrings.

I seem to recall there was also a flush bug fixed since 5.5 that makes things slower since then but made 5.5 not entirely crash-safe.
